Defect Summary

Honda (american honda motor co.) is recalling certain model year 2016 civic vehicles manufactured september 22, 2015, to february 3, 2016 and equipped with 2.0l engines. the affected vehicles have engines with piston assemblies that may have been manufactured without a piston wrist pin circlip or with an incorrectly installed piston wrist pin circlip.

Corrective Action

Honda will notify owners, and dealers will inspect and replace the piston assemblies and damaged engine components, as necessary, free of charge. parts are expected to be available in the summer of 2016. owners were mailed an interim notification beginning march 31, 2016, and will be mailed a second notice when parts are available. owners may contact hon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. honda's number for this recall is jx9.

Consequence Summary: If a circlip is missing or incorrectly installed, the piston wrist pin may not be secure and may drift and damage the engine cylinder causing the engine to seize, and increasing the risk of a crash or a fire.
